As a Viet person, I have had better banh mi and pho than this place serves. My grandma literally owned a pho restaurant in... Vietnam for 30+ years now. I am not going to compare this pho/banh mi to what you find in Vietnam, but rather what they havehere in the metro ATL area. Is it the best Vietnamese you can find on this side of town? Sure. Once you step intoBuford/Duluth/Chamblee area? Not even close. Personally, the pho is very light flavored. The banh mi is super simple tasting.The tea wasn’t really sweet and definitely had more half and half than it normally has. Overall, would I eat it if I washungry and in a pinch for Viet food? Of course. Is this my favorite Viet place to eat and recommend to anyone who wants to knowwhat Viet food tastes like? Probably not. If you want authentic Viet food that is going to blow your mind? There are plenty ofplaces around Chamblee and Buford that is perfect for you. If you just want something quick and easy on the way to class andcan’t be bothered about taste as much, give this place a shot. Read more
